As discussed during the dispatch call, emergency services responded to a 63-year-old man at San Diego airport who experienced near-fainting and vertigo. The man had a dirt bike accident the previous day where he briefly lost consciousness. He later felt dizzy and collapsed without injury while at the airport. He showed no signs of stroke or chest pain. Medical staff monitored his condition cautiously due to his age and injury history. The incident may involve complications from the earlier crash.
